**Leadership Review Briefing: Proposed Acquisition of Tallowin Systems**

For heads of department. Diligence on Tallowin Systems is substantially complete. Their scheduling platform, Quillgate, complements our logistics suite with minimal overlap. Financial review shows stable recurring revenue and modest debt; integration costs are estimated conservatively. Cultural fit was assessed as favourable during site visits to their Abernock office. Retention packages for key engineers are drafted. Our underlying strategic intent is stated below.

board note of bawep-tajef: Queniusek Systems plans to raise the Quenvan list price by 53.1 percent in March. The pricing group signed off on a budget of $176.4 million for Project Drueth. The renewal with Casionix Partners closes at $142.5 million a year, 8.3 percent below the last contract. Project Fraax slips by six weeks because of the tooling delay.

## Tuning

FeeCrafter's rules engine decides shipping fees per order, and yes, the defaults are opinionated. If a merchant on the Parcelgrove plan complains about weird surcharges, it's almost always one of the knobs below rather than a bug. Changing a value takes effect on the next rule reload, so no restart needed — just don't crank the distance multiplier without checking with eng. Current defaults follow.

tuning table, kageg-kagap:
CAPS = {
    "druox": 842,
    "quenax": 605,
    "zormir": 107,
    "tamwyn": 577,
    "kasok": 688,
}

**Mgmt Meeting Minutes — Retiring the Brightline Range**

Quick recap for sales leads at Fenholt Supplies: we agreed to retire the Brightline fixture range by year-end. Remaining stock moves to clearance pricing next month, and accounts on standing orders get migrated to the Lumetta range. Trade-in incentives were approved in principle. The confidential note on next steps sits just below.

board note of bajof-bajeg: The pricing group signed off on a budget of $13.4 million for Project Sildor. The renewal with Lamixek Holdings closes at $48.9 million a year, 49 percent above the last contract.

## Configuration

Stockpath, the restock planner from Fennmarch Vending Systems, reads all settings from a single .env file at startup. Non-sensitive options (depot region, route cadence, machine capacity defaults) are documented inline in env.example. One credential is required: the planner API token, which the service refuses to boot without. Add it directly beneath this paragraph.

sealed setting: VAULT_KEY20=c8ea1e419912889df6b4